My husband and I have never purchased the "drink package". Is it worth it? It will just be us 2---no kiddos--- so we do plan to have some good ole "adult time" and have adult beverages every day..... What is included in the drink package? He drinks beer, i do not... i like wine, frozen drinks (MIami Vice), Malibu/pineapple- girly drinks like that...are those inlcluded? Thanks for your input!!

 

Basically every drink on the ship that is under $13 is included. Wine, beer, mixed drinks, frozen drinks, specialty coffee, water, soda, fresh OJ.

 

Above $13 you just pay the amount over $13 plus gratuity on the amount over.

My husband and I have never purchased the "drink package". Is it worth it? It will just be us 2---no kiddos--- so we do plan to have some good ole "adult time" and have adult beverages every day..... What is included in the drink package? He drinks beer, i do not... i like wine, frozen drinks (MIami Vice), Malibu/pineapple- girly drinks like that...are those inlcluded? Thanks for your input!!

 

Yes, as most have said.. Most ships are $12 per drink max or $13 depending on what ship you go to... and you just pay the difference + 18% grat if you get something that's over your max per drink.. We sail this Friday (Yay!) and it's the first time I've bought the package and I did the simple math.. If you drink 4, $12 dollar drinks a day (or a mixture of drinks, soda, juice, etc), you will be in the Black. I don't remember what I paid for my package, but it's right about $38 to $40 per day. I am not a hard core drinker, but I can put them back and that shouldn't be an issue... and I can even make up for my wife lol.. Any type drink you can think of (and even the ones you've listed) will be available for less then $12.. Unless you ask for all top shelf whiskey's in them, so you may have to bite the bullet and have a couple more a day to break even, darn lol... A Malibu Bay Breeze won't be $12 and glasses of most wines are under or at the max level of $12 or $13, respectfully; and bottles of beer are anywhere between $5 and $8ish per bottle.

 

You can also search these boards and I'm sure someone has posted a price list of each drink on your ship.. and also remember, you get everything (vice some coffee's) included in your package - fresh squeezed juices, soda, water bottles, virgin drinks, etc., so IMHO, the drink package is SOOO worth it.. You most definitely don't have to drink like a fish to, at the least, break even.. Oh, one more thing. I'm sure it's the same or almost the same on all RC ships, but you also get a discount on bottles of wine with the drink package.. I get 40% off bottles that are $100 or less, and 20% off (I think) if they are over $100.. So, you also get deals beyond just your day to day (or hour to hour lol) drinks you get...
